Competition Declaration
"Residences" should not be merely places for consumption. Regardless of how minute the connection, how should the residential form be changed for it to be a part of the economic activities in the community circle? I hope that everyone can begin to think from the perspective of "enabling the residence and the community circle to form a quality connection so that financial assets can smoothly circulate within.” From a spatial perspective, how can such a goal be achieved through design?
Encounter at Home
This design attempts to create a compulsive neighborhood relationship. Let residents get used to this lifestyle. I tried to find the essential meaning of street aesthetics--humanity, and create space like lanes and arcades, which is regarded as an extension of the home. Therefore, private and public spaces can communicate here, and the possibility of connecting with households is also created. "Meeting" is another function of the home in such a space.
The lack of interpersonal interaction in modern house caused the house become a place where only shelter and child-raising . The residents are therefore indifferent to each other. The reason is that in addition to the isolation of the dwelling unit, this situation also include the lack of interaction. So I started with the possibility of resident interaction, combined circulation to connect residential unit space, and made shopping behavior become an important opportunity for interaction. Therefore, the interaction between people; the way of trading behavior is the focus of my design. |
This design started from the observation of the vital urban space in Taiwan. I analyzed the spatial composition of such interactions. Further converted to residential unit prototypes and the possibility of massive modularization.
